Understanding Eco-Architecture

Eco-architecture refers to the design of buildings and communities that minimize environmental impact while promoting energy efficiency, sustainability, and harmony with nature. This approach respects local ecosystems and utilizes sustainable materials, creating structures that not only meet human needs but also protect the planet.

Core Principles of Eco-Architecture

  • Sustainability: Prioritizing renewable resources and materials that can be recycled or reused.
  • Energy Efficiency: Designing buildings to reduce energy consumption through insulation, natural light, and efficient appliances.
  • Water Conservation: Implementing systems for rainwater harvesting and recycling greywater.
  • Community Integration: Creating spaces that consider the well-being of residents and foster a sense of community.

Green Technology Solutions

Advancements in technology are paving the way for a more sustainable construction industry. Here are some key green technologies transforming the landscape of architecture:

1. Solar Energy

Solar panels have become a staple in sustainable architecture, harnessing the sun’s energy to power homes, businesses, and even entire communities.

2. Green Roofs

Green roofs or living roofs provide insulation, reduce urban heat, and promote biodiversity by allowing vegetation to grow on rooftops.

3. Smart Building Technologies

Smart technologies optimize energy use through automated systems that adjust lighting, heating, and cooling based on occupancy and environmental conditions.

4. Sustainable Materials

The use of recyclable, renewable, and non-toxic materials in construction reduces the carbon footprint and enhances building longevity.
